2010 SESSION
SB 361 Religious holidays; student's absence because of observance thereof must be recorded as excused.
Introduced by: George L. Barker |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les
SUMMARY AS PASSED SENATE: (all summaries)
Religious holidays; attendance records. Requires local school boards to develop policies ensuring that any student's absence because of the observance of a religious holiday be recorded as excused on the student's attendance record and that a student not be deprived of any award or of eligibility or opportunity to compete for any award or of the right to take an alternate test or examination, for any which he missed because of such absence.
